South Africa, rich in wildlife and scenic beauty, is called "A World In One Country" with three climate zones, two oceans, deserts, subtropical savannah and mountain ranges. Now a democratic country after decades of apartheid, South Africa has a diverse cultures, hence its other nickname "The Rainbow Nation." Cape Town is one of the most exciting and sophisticated cities in the world with endless natural beauty, distinct architecture and wine culture. Wildlife areas in South Africa are exceptional, including the world renowned Kruger National Park and neighboring private reserves with numerous lodges to choose from ranging in style from rustic to superior luxury.
Area: 1,219,090 sq/km (470,693 sq/m) ▪ Population: 45,000,000 ▪ Languages: English, Afrikaans, Ndebele, Pedi, Sotho, Swazi, Venda, Tsonga, Xhosa, Zulu, Tswana ▪ Currency: Rand ▪ Economy: Tourism, gold, diamonds, platinum, fruit, wheat, beef, machinery.
